Jwalk0 wrote:Earthbound
First played this when I wuz 8 and I enjoyed every minute of it. Only reason why I wanted my mom to get it at the time wuz because it wuz packaged in a big-ass box even though I've never heard of the game beforehand, I didn't expect to have my mind blown so much from the game. Took me over a year to beat it back then but now I can do it in 3 days. Till this day I haven't experienced a single boss fight as creepy as the final one in this game, Giygas is a fuckin trip and what makes the fight even more creepy is the fact that the entire game before it wuz lighthearted, almost kid-friendly and a bit humorous. Then as soon as you get to him it's like a visual and psychological trip to Hell
